I'm always interested in something that goes for a theme of melding or conflict between technology and organic life so I was excited for this one before I even hit play.
I think you managed to convey that idea really nicely through the sound selection you describe in the description as well as making the different sound palettes work together in a way that they each complement and play to each others' strengths really well.
Some really nice sound design on some of the synths too, as well as doing a great job bending the stick and rock sounds into percussion.
Great variety of different moods that all feel like part of one coherent soundtrack too.
Not really about the music per se but I also like the decision to name each track like it's a file type.